Search
Learn
Dispensaries
For Business
Open main menu
Dashboard
Dispensaries
Oklahoma
Wilburton
Royal Leaf Dispensary 2
Royal Leaf Dispensary 2
+1 918-917-5180
117 E Main St, Wilburton, OK 74578, USA
View Menu
Dispensary rating:
★
★
★
★
★